Formation Professionnelle
Présentiel
Pas d'apprentissage

Type

Catégorie de la certification

Certification inscrite au Répertoire Spécifique (RS)

Niveau de sortie

Niveau reconnu si applicable

N/C

Prix

Indiqué par l'établissement

3 100 €

Présentation

-

Formation dispensée en Présentiel à l'adresse suivante :

Localisation & Rattachements

Département
Somme
Région
Hauts-de-France
Coordonnées géographiques indisponibles

Objectifs

Être capable :
o d'enregistrer et optimiser des macros
o d'écrire des procédures en langage VBA
des tâches répétitives ainsi que des événements
provoqués par Excel ou par d'autres utilisateurs
o de créer un formulaire modifiant des données
Exce
o obtenir la certification TOSA avec un score de 551 points minimum sur 1 000

Débouchés / Résultats attendus

o Document d'évaluation de satisfaction
o Attestation de présence
o Exercices pratiques de validation des acquis sous
contrôle du formateuro Prépare au passage du TOSA

Programme & Référentiel

Présentation
o Barre d'outils Visual Basic
o L'éditeur de Visual Basic VBE
o Sécurité des macros
o Configuration de l'éditeur de macros

Les macros
Définitions - Macros
Enregistrer une macro
o Enregistrement d'une macro - Options
o Les limites de l'enregistrement
d'une macro
o Visualisation du code VBA
o Modification d'une macro enregistrée
Exécuter une macro
o Les affectations de macro (bouton,
objet graphique, barre d'outils,
menu...)
o Exécuter une macro pas à pas

Le VBA
Principes fondamentaux
du VBA
o Les procédures SUB et FUNCTION
o Les procédures événementielles et procédurales

Les Objets Excel
o Travailler avec les cellules Excel
o Les propriétés
o Les méthodes
o L'instruction With

Les messages
o Affichage d'une boîte de dialogue
o Affichage d'une boîte de saisie

Les Structures de Contrôle VBA
o L'Instruction If Then
o L'instruction For Next
o L'instruction Select Case
o L'instruction While Wend
o L'instruction Do Loop While

Gestion des erreurs
(ON ERROR...)
o Intérêt de la gestion d'erreurs
o On Error GoTo
o On Error GoTo 0
o On Error Resume Next

Fonctions supplémentaires
o Opérations sur les chaînes
de caractères
o Opérations sur les dates
o Opérations sur les valeurs numériques

Les tableaux
o Déclaration d'un tableau
(une et plusieurs dimensions)
o Gestion de tableaux virtuels
o Gestion de tableaux à multiples
dimensions
o Récupération des tableaux Excel

Les Formulaires (USERFORMS)
o Définition
o Création
o Affichage
o Les différents contrôles
o Rendre un contrôle dépendant d'un
autre
o Faire réagir les contrôles à la souris
o Propriétés des contrôles
o Gestion du clavier
o Manipulation à partir de VBA